在当今的IT领域,Redis和OpenSSH-Server是两款不可或缺的软件工具。Redis以其高性能的键值存储特性,成为了众多开发者首选的内存数据库;而OpenSSH-Server则以其强大的加密功能,保障了远程登录的安全性。接下来,我们将详细介绍如何在CentOS系统上安装这两款软件。
一、CentOS安装Redis
-
更新系统:首先,确保你的CentOS系统是最新的。可以通过运行
sudo yum update
命令来更新系统。 -
安装EPEL仓库:Redis的官方软件包并未包含在CentOS的默认仓库中,因此需要安装EPEL(Extra Packages for Enterprise Linux)仓库。运行
sudo yum install epel-release
命令进行安装。 -
安装Redis:接下来,运行
sudo yum install redis
命令来安装Redis。 -
启动Redis:安装完成后,通过
sudo systemctl start redis
命令启动Redis服务,并使用sudo systemctl enable redis
命令设置Redis开机自启。
二、CentOS安装OpenSSH-Server
-
检查OpenSSH-Server是否已安装:CentOS系统通常默认安装了OpenSSH-Server。你可以通过运行
sudo systemctl status sshd
命令来检查其状态。 -
安装OpenSSH-Server(如未安装):若系统未安装,可通过运行
sudo yum install openssh-server
命令进行安装。 -
启动并启用OpenSSH-Server:安装完成后,通过
sudo systemctl start sshd
命令启动服务,并使用sudo systemctl enable sshd
命令设置开机自启。
重点提示:在安装和配置过程中,请务必注意防火墙设置,确保Redis和SSH的端口(默认为6379和22)能够正常访问。同时,为了增强安全性,建议为Redis和SSH设置强密码,并定期更新。
通过以上步骤,你就可以在CentOS系统上成功安装并配置Redis和OpenSSH-Server了。这两款软件将为你的开发和运维工作提供强大的支持。